What is ASTM a 283?

The ASTM A283 specification is the Standard Specification for Low and Intermediate Tensile Strength Carbon Steel Plates used in general structural applications.

What is ASTM A283 Grade c used for?

This ASTM specification covers low and intermediate strength carbon steel plates. Used for general purpose structural applications of medium strength (60 ksi tensile) requirement. Machinability of the steel covered by this specification is good, as for any low carbon steel.

What is ASTM A516?

The ASTM A516 specification is the Standard Specification for Pressure Vessel Plates, Carbon Steel, for Moderate- and Lower-Temperature Service for plates used in pressure vessel applications where excellent notch toughness is required.

What is the yield strength of a36 steel?

Mechanical properties of flat, rolled, and structural ASTM A36 steel

Yield strength, MPa (min) Tensile strength, MPa Elongation (sample 200 mm),% (min)
250 400-550 20

What kind of material is ASTM 283 Gr c?

ASTM A 283 Gr C consist of four grade of material (A,B,C, & D) of carbon steel plate of structural quality for general application. ASTM A 36 covers carbon steel plate, shape, and bar of structural quality for use in riveted, bolted or welded construction of bridges and building and for general structural purpose.

What are the uses of 283 C steel?

Application:Mainly Used in the manufacture of anchor bolt, shares, funnel, roof board, rivet, low carbon steel wire, sheet, welding tube, rod, hook, support, welding structure.
